Ingredients: 1 - Package Fresh Rosemary 1 - Package Fresh Thyme 1 - Choice Bone-in Ribeye 1 - package of Whole Mushrooms 1 - stick Kerrygold butter 1 - bundle of Chives (for the frills) 1 - bottle of cheap Soy Sauce ¼ cup - Heavy Cream Kosmos Q Cow Cover Rub Kosmos Q Texas Beef Rub Recipe: Step 1 - Marinate your steak in a generous amount of soy sauce for about 30-45 minutes. These steaks are about 1in ¼ thick so if your steak is thinner, cut the time down a bit so it doesn’t get too salty. Step 2 - Push all the air out of the plastic bag and throw it in the fridge. Step 3 - Get the cooker going and get your coals nice and hot for an indirect cook. Step 4 - Pull that steak out of the marinade, season generously with Cow Cover and Texas Beef (or whatever you have/like) Step 5 - Start your mushrooms in the cast iron, or do these on the stove if you prefer. Step 6 - Put the steak opposite of the fire until it reaches 100 Degrees F. Then sear it and baste it with some herb butter while she rests! Pull your steak at 127 degrees F for perfect medium-rare doneness! Step 7 - Take this opportunity to add the heavy cream to start thickening up the mushroom cream sauce. Step 8 - Let your steak rest for at least 15 minutes and carve it up nice and pretty.
